#b6c65f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6c65f is composed of 71.4% red, 77.6%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 52%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 69.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.5% and a lightness of 57.5%. #b6c65f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be with #6d8d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b6c65f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6c65f has RGB values of R:182, G:198,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 11978335.

Shades and Tints of #b6c65f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0e05 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6c65f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939491 is the less saturated color, while #d9f82d is the most saturated one.
